Iraqi Pilgrims Injured in Bus Crash in West Iran

TEHRAN (IQNA) – At least 22 people were injured after a bus carrying Iraqi pilgrims plunged off a road and overturned in Iran’s western province of Lorestan, an official said.

 

Hossein Ali Refaei, head of the province’s medical emergencies center, told reporters on Sunday that the bus crash happened on the road between the cities of Khorramabad and Koohdasht on Saturday night.

He added that at least 22 people were injured in the incident.

According to the official, the injured were transferred to a hospital in Khorramabad, the provincial capital.

Every year millions of Iranians go to Iraq and millions of Iraqis travel to Iran for visits to the two countries’ pilgrimage sites.
